(November 13, 2012) Buckner, MO – The wraps will officially be placed on the 2012 season for the Lucas Oil MLRA this Friday night at the annual Awards Banquet. For the third straight year, it will take place at Harrah’s Casino in Kansas City, MO. The evening will be a chance to gather and celebrate the championship of John Anderson, as well as the accomplishments of Mark Dotson, 2012 Rookie of the Year. It will also be a special time, as we thank and honor, Harriett and Cowboy Chancellor, for their sixteen years of dedication and hard work to make the Lucas Oil MLRA a success.

John Anderson secured his third overall title, with the Lucas Oil MLRA, by scoring five wins, along with an average finish of 4.8 for the season. Heading into the final weekend of competition, his average finish was an astounding 2.9. To go along with the wins, there were six additional times he either finished second or third. Anderson drives for Greg and Pat Junghans, who reside in Manhattan, KS. Junghans owns a stable of MasterSbilt Race Cars powered by Jay Dickens Engines. Anderson currently sits fifth on the all-time Lucas Oil MLRA wins list with twenty-nine checkered flags.

It was a season of learning for Mark Dotson behind the wheel of his Barry Wright Race Car. He has raced for several years, but prior to beginning the season, Dotson had never even tested a Dirt Late Model. It was a trial by fire, and he more than held his own. Dotson raced in the feature event in all but two shows this season. Topping his finish list was a third place effort at LA Raceway in La Monte, MO in early June. There were seven top ten runs along the way for “Fluffy.” In addition to the Rookie of the Year crown, Dotson was third in series points.

Final 2012 Standings
1st JOHN ANDERSON 1381
2nd JESSE STOVALL 1097
3rd MARK DOTSON 1096
4th KEVIN SATHER 812
5th TERRY PHILLIPS 783
6th WILL VAUGHT 767
7th TONY JACKSON JR 707
8th CHAD SIMPSON 667
9th BILL LEIGHTON 657
10th CHRIS SIMPSON 574
11th ERIC TURNER 555
12th JUSTIN ASPLIN 549
13th DAVID TURNER 526
14th MIKE COLLINS 522
15th KYLE BERCK 518
16th DAVE ECKRICH 503
17th BILL KOONS 480
18th MATT JOHNSON 467
19th DUSTIN WALKER 451
20th TOMMY WEDER JR 426
